she372po-115016-Oasis PoolFollowing the extensive $26 million renovations of the resort and lagoons, the property’s iconic Oasis Pool and surrounds have just been fully refurbished, to the tune of $250,000 and it is simply exquisite.

In an impressive Green initiative, the refurbishment’s goal to improve the aesthetics of the pool and its surrounding areas also placed emphasis on reducing the pool’s energy and water consumption. A push that is in-line with Starwood’s objective to reduce energy and water usage – the “30/20 by 20” initiative has set a target of reducing energy use by 30% and water use by 20% by the year 2020.
